Closing Date: 09/07/2026 | Full Time Arts & Business NI is seeking an organised, proactive and motivated Membership Engagement Officer to build engagement across their Membership community. Reporting to the Head of Business, you will play a key role in delivering our membership engagement strategy, strengthening relationships with members, and supporting retention and sustainable growth. Key Details Membership Engagement Officer Location: A&BNI, East Belfast Network Centre, 55 Templemore Avenue, Belfast (flexible options available) Salary & hours: £30,000 (depending on experience) Full-time (35 hours per week) Application deadline: Thurs 9 July 2026, 12 Noon Apply Here: Join our Team! Membership Engagement Officer – Arts & Business Northern Ireland About You You are organised, creative and people-focused, with a strong interest in Northern Ireland’s vibrant cultural sector. You enjoy developing new ideas, managing multiple priorities and working both independently and collaboratively. You are confident presenting to clients and stakeholders, comfortable using CRM systems, and able to interpret engagement data to inform strategic decision-making. Essential Skills & Experience • At least two years’ experience in a membership, fundraising or client-focused role with responsibility for engagement and retention •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, including stakeholder presentations • Strong organisational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ities effectively • High attention to detail and commitment to accuracy • Ability to take ownership of projects and deliver measurable outcomes • Strong interpersonal and relationship-building skills • Experience using CRM systems to track engagement and analyse data • Competence in using Microsoft Office software, Excel reporting and insight generation • Experience in business development, account management, membership sales or relationship management with responsibility for achieving growth or retention targets. • Desirable Experience • Support marketing activity such as social media scheduling or content updates • Using design tools such as Canva • Coordinating or delivering events • Experience of email marketing platforms and distributing newsletters or member communications.
